I get asked from time to time after I just get over a cold how the heck do I manage to clear my voice and sing when my range is being limited form left over crud from a cold.

Heres a secret I learned while working in Vegas for 6 years as an opening act for major name acts when the Show absolutely must go on.

Simple...HOT water, Lemon Juice < from a fresh lemon , and some honey. It will strip the crud off your vocal cords in a snap!!

It's a nice to know..I have even used it on what I call Union Voice.. /< That's a voice that only wants to sing at night and is not so good in the morning.. Anyway it works for me!!

Throat coat is a tea that is made almost entirely of licorice root. It works rather nicely. However, I prefer to mix my own tea of licorice root and peppermint. Throat Coat is a tea put out by a company called Traditional Medicinals. It's wonderful! I also like Breathe Easy by the same company. It's good for asthma and allergy related problems.

Another one is hot ginger root tea. If you have allergies or a clogged head it will help open the sinus and clear the throat very nicely. It will also stay with you for about 4 to 5 hrs.

Interesting thread. I tend to go more for the source of the crud and do what I can to clear my sinus cavities as much as possible. Levage (Neti) is pretty good for getting the dam broken in there. Also do a lot of Lessac "y-buzz" and low "call" work if I can. Lots of water. All the time. As much as possible.
